Cleric condemns US over boycott of Iran's Al-Mustafa University

Manager of Iran seminaries has issued a statement on Tuesday to condemn the US treasury over boycotting Iran's Al-Mustafa International University calling that as a proof for arrogant and domineering nature of the United States.

Ayatollah Alireza A'rafi, member of the council at Al-Mustafa University in his message referred to the history of the religious academy, number of graduates and the effective role of the university in promoting Islamic education and research, reported Taqrib News Agency (TNA).
 
The cleric in part of his message wrote," To boycott such academy which serves humanity, advancement, justice and fact-finding is more of a proof for the arrogant and domineering nature of the United States."
Ayatollah A'rafi added," It is not surprising to see this behavior from a government with a long record of aggression, oppression, bloodshed and betrayal of other nations and also assassination of scientific elites particularly from Muslim countries."
 
Manager of seminaries in this statement condemned the illegal and inhumane act by the US treasury and stressed the hostile move will be in vain and quicken annihilation of the United States and world Zionism.
The U.S. Department of the Treasury’s Office of Foreign Assets Control (OFAC) has boycotted Iran’s Al-Mustafa International University for alleged facilitating IRGC-QF recruitment efforts and Iran's envoy to Yemen in early December.
